What is the LZ30 Therapy Laser?

LASER stands for Light Amplification of Stimulated Emission of Radiation. This advanced technology delivers a focused beam of healing light energy that is non-ionizing, meaning it’s completely safe and does not collect in your tissues. The LZ30 Therapy Laser is a powerful tool to address pain, promote healing, and improve overall wellness.

  • Infrared Laser Light: Targets the point of pain or injury to reduce discomfort, stabilize the area, and speed up tissue healing. Perfect for addressing acute injuries or localized pain.
  •  
  • Red Laser Light: Works globally by stimulating your cells’ mitochondria to produce ATP—the energy your cells need to heal and function at their peak. This helps treat underlying causes of chronic conditions.
